    Today’s Topic: Improving relationships, excelling in business, and managing your weakness.   Kim and I are newly obsessed with the StrengthsFinder assessment, and this week we’re going to share how you can leverage this tool to improve your relationships, excel in business, and manage your weakness.   What is StrengthsFinder?   This assessment measures and ranks you on a unique set of 34 natural talents, as opposed to skills, and identifies your five greatest strengths.   When you become aware of your strengths – and the strengths of the people you live with or work with – it’s easier to take advantage of each others’ strengths and work as an effective team. Can you imagine what using this knowledge can do for a business team, or a couple?   You can take the Gallup StrengthsFinder test here: gallupstrengthscenter.com.   We recommend taking the full 34-strength test. It’s a little more expensive than just the top five, but it’s just as helpful to know what your weaknesses are so that you can better manage them
